WebApr 6, 2024 · Place the sponge or towel on the adhesive; After at least 30 minutes to an hour, test effectiveness; Repeat if necessary. Some DIY fanatics have found the best success with adhesive removers after they have allowed their soaked sponge or towel to sit on the old glue overnight, allowing time for the bonds to dissolve. The only time you may not need to install underlayment is if there is already a pad attached to the LVP flooring you have purchased. WebLIQUID NAILS ® Subfloor & Deck Construction Adhesive (LN-602/LNP-602) is a specially formulated weatherproof-grade adhesive for interior and exterior construction, offering easy cold weather gunning ability. Penetrates wet, frozen and treated lumber. Ideal for bonding common building materials to concrete, and can bridge gaps up to 3/8".

WebOne type of linoleum flooring does not require adhesive for installation. Tongue-and-groove boards laid on the floor lock together to create a solid floor above the subfloor. It typically comes in 4 x 8-foot sheets.
